Steve & Kate's Camp

Steve and Kate Susskind created a summer camp in 1980 to promote kids' independence, now with over 70 locations.

About:Way back in 1980, Steve and Kate saw kids’ precious independence slipping away. (Yes–Steve and Kate Susskind are real people!) So they set out to do something about it by creating a summer camp. Today, we’ve spawned more than 70 glorious islands of freedom from Manhattan to Manhattan Beach.
